Seven Veils wins at Kenilworth for Straight Bat Racing

A great way to start 2010 !!  4 year old filly SEVEN VEILS won a 1200m sprint by a clear 2½ lengths at Kenilworth this afternoon in the colours of the Allan Bloodlines racing club STRAIGHT BAT RACING.  Trained by Vaughan Marshall and ridden by Marco Latorre, the daughter of Rich Man’s Gold returned to form in her first outing in Cape Town.

Purchased by Allan Bloodlines at the National Yearling Sales for R 200,000 from top breeder Wilgerbosdrift, SEVEN VEILS had won at 3 in training with Alistair Gordon in Durban.  But after several months of subsequent lung infections or allergies and a long break at Balmoral Stud in the KwaZuluNatal Midlands, Alistair himself suggested a change and the filly was transferred to Allan’s main Cape Town base with Vaughan Marshall.

Two wins and two places from eight starts is a fair record, but her return to form in this fillies’ handicap may now lead to runs in Stakes races in Cape Town and/or Port Elizabeth.
